Business challenges are forcing organisations to change at an ever increasing rate. These pressures mean that it is no longer enough to design and implement change; real progress in the short term has to be clear and demonstrable. However, more than 50% of change initiatives do not have the intended organisational impact; complex interdependencies and "knock-on" effects mean even simple proposals can lead to an unexpected outcome. Many organisations now achieve organisational progress through a programme approach that firstly identifies the different tasks required to achieve progress and then manages their delivery. ...
